UK Polling History: Election of 27 October 1931 – Bolton
Result summary
Parties | ||
Conservative | Labour | |
Votes | 66,014 | 33,947 |
Votes gained | +29,235 | -8,027 |
Share of votes | 66.0% | 34.0% |
Share of eligible voters | 53.7% | 27.6% |
Gain in share of votes | +29.8% | -7.4% |
Gain in share of eligible voters | +23.2% | -7.2% |
Total votes: | 99,961 | |
Electorate: | 122,912 | |
Turnout: | 81.3% | |
Outcome: | Conservative gain from Labour | |
Swing: | 18.6% | Conservative from Labour |
